> You might be interested in Jekkyl, a Ruby program that is a  blog-aware,
> static  web sites generator. It basically generates HTML out of tex,haml,
> textile files.
>
> check it out: http://github.com/mojombo/jekyll/
> Example sites: http://wiki.github.com/mojombo/jekyll/sites
>
> So what does it have to do with Org? well, some guy developed a nice way of
> using the power of Jekky with Org. It uses org as a backed to generate the
> html, he prepoceses it and then generates the site using Jekyll.
